CNET reports that Google has started placing National Archives videos online. The videos are all public domain and include a lot of United Newsreel, NASA, and Department of the Interior films. Google Video product manager Peter Chane said the company is working in stages to put as many as possible of the National Archives' 114,000 film reels and 37,000 videos online. Very cool.
